Job description

This is a great opportunity to work for the UK's leading veterinary wholesaler.

Our business provides a next day supply and distribution service through our nationwide network of distribution depots, serving an average of 2750 customers every day.

This role will require interaction with our customers as well as internal stakeholders, product owners, and existing applications to elicit new requirements and turn them into prioritised agile features and stories, lining them up for development and managing them through the pipeline to coordinate with our release schedules for both our online and mobile products.

The role will also include development tasks such as bug fixes, new functionality, unit testing, and code reviews.

Key Responsibilities

Typically activities will include:

  • Liaising with customers and internal stakeholders to elicit requirements
  • Meeting and workshop facilitation for requirements
  • Managing and facilitating agile meetings
  • Feature writing
  • Story writing
  • Creation of acceptance criteria
  • Working closely with developers as part of an agile team to deliver features and stories.
  • Test scripting and testing using agile techniques
  • Maintaining agile backlogs
  • Supporting our product owners
  • Participating in Agile ceremonies
  • Writing new code or updating and fixing existing code using C# and .NET
  • Writing SQL queries and designing database tables
  • Creating unit tests
  • Using source control

Contributing to strategic decision making about the direction of our products.
